An Act relative to protecting municipalities from unfunded mandates
Summary
By Representatives Kane of Shrewsbury and Arciero of Westford, a petition (accompanied by bill, House, No. 1949) of Hannah Kane, James Arciero and others for legislation to require that fiscal notes be attached to legislation providing unfunded mandates on municipal governments. Ways and Means.
